Funding Purpose and Recapture of Finds. In accordance with the terms hereof, the Recipient Organization (the <br />"Recipient ") agrees to receive certain award funds under the Ohio Law Enforcement Body Armor Program (the "Funds ") for <br />a 75% reimbursement of the purchase price of bulletproof vests purchased pursuant to the Ohio Law Enforcement Body <br />Armor Program, The Recipient agrees that it will be liable to repay any Funds spent in a manner inconsistent with this <br />Agreement or the stated purpose as determined by the Ohio Attorney General (the "Attorney General "). This Award <br />Acceptance may only be modified in a writing signed by the Attorney General and the Recipient. <br />CLVIII,Lirnitations on Use of Funds. Funds received under the Ohio Law Enforcement Body Armor Program will not <br />be used for any political campaign or governmental lobbying in a partisan manner. Purchases of bulletproof vests must have <br />been made during the Award Period as stated above in order to be reimbursed. <br />CLIX. Disbursement of Funds. Direct payments will be made by Electronic Funds Transfers to Recipients that have <br />submitted an Authorization Agreement for Direct Deposit of EFT Payments form to the Attorney General. Otherwise, <br />payment will be made by check from the Office of Budget and Management. For all awards, the Funds will be disbursed upon <br />receipt from tine Recipient of this signed Award Acceptance and a completed Request for Payment Form including all <br />necessary documentation of the purchase, and upon Attorney General approval, In order to be reimbursed, all required <br />documentation must be submitted by June 30, 2019 via e -mail to Ohie>I.F_Bach,.1tn��rjt _(.)aioattnmetGeuet; gqv. <br />Disbursements are contingent upon the timely submission and approval of all required documentation (which may include, <br />but is not limited to, original invoices and receipts). No payments will be made after Jame 30, 2019. <br />CLX. Liability. Recipient agrees that the Attorney General and the Ohio Bureau of Workers' Compensation are not <br />responsible for the operation of the bulletproof vests purchased pursuant to this program. In the event of an injury or <br />occupational disease arising from the implementation of the program, the Recipient and the employee's sole and exclusive <br />remedy shall be pursuant to the workers' compensation laws of the appropriate jurisdiction. <br />CLXI.
